Arnold C4D Hair UVs

Hello there. I'm trying to figure out how to create some sort of animal fur, with spots and stripes of different color, but when I connect a noise map to the Base Color port of the standard hair shader, the noise is applied but it's not "sticking", and it looks like a projection. Can anyone point me to what's the correct workflow for creating this? Thanks.

Add an Arnold tag to the Hair object and enable Export UVs. Select the UV space in the noise.

If you want an artistic look, not necessary realistic, then you might want to enable Diffuse in the standard_hair shader and connect the shader to the Diffuse Color.
